Have not I the right to keep one's own secret,
Prison doors restrain one's freedoms and one's rights,
Eyes have long forgotten the beauty of light,
I only hold the truth... truth wanted by many,
Must I stand before all else with my shame,
The scarlet letter burns my soul and future,
guilt spreads across one's face, my compunction,

Gleaming eyes beat down on me... judging me,
Can one not bear own sins within themselves,
Demanding truth which I shall never give them,
They do not KNOW me... yet they still judge me,
Desire to end the suffering and agony,
My decisions... shattering my self-worth,
Have not I the right to keep one's own secret.
